Overview: We are looking for a candidate that our client wants to hire immediately for a Senior Civil Engineer. This role is& for a growing and nationally recognized engineering firm. This role is ideal for a licensed Professional Engineer (PE) who thrives in a collaborative environment and is passionate about leading civil design projects across multiple sectors including federal, healthcare, industrial, and commercial. This is a unique opportunity to join the Civil Team Leadership Group, where your technical expertise will directly impact both client deliverables and internal process improvements. You’ll support large-scale, multi-discipline site development projects while mentoring junior designers and guiding design system templates and QAQC procedures. Key Responsibilities: Serve as technical lead on civil site development projects of various sizes and scopes.
Develop site designs using AutoCAD Civil 3D and align with applicable local, regional, and federal codes.
Lead multi-disciplinary teams on complex infrastructure, government, or commercial projects.
Coordinate with stakeholders, clients, and municipalities for reviews, permitting, and approvals.
Review site surveys, geotechnical reports, and perform grading, drainage, and utility designs.
Contribute to team-wide initiatives including process development and QA/QC checklists.
Prepare proposals, cost estimates, and project documentation.
Minimum Qualifications: Professional Engineering (PE) License — active and valid in multiple U.S. states.
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Civil Engineering from an ABET-accredited program.
5–10 years of experience in civil design, site development, or infrastructure projects.
Proficiency in AutoCAD Civil 3D is required.
Strong written and verbal communication skills for client interactions and internal coordination.
Experience in preparing design reports, construction documents, and permit applications.
Willingness to travel occasionally for site documentation and client meetings.
Preferred Experience: Familiarity with Federal Facility Criteria (Whole Building Design Guide).
Experience working on projects for government, municipal, and life science clients.
Ability to lead project scoping, estimating, and proposal writing.
